By Josh H.
Date: October 10, 2022
Bought this for a Kilimanjaro hike which was just completed yesterday (Oct 2022). Definitely kept the rain off me in the rainforest areas and Moreland landscape. I wore this over top of merino wool base layers, and also that plus a thick fleece when it was super cold.Good quality so far! Only gripe is the stupid hood is wayyy too big. I pull it up and it covers my eyes and nose. No good. But it's totally fine if you have a ball cap on. The brim of the cap prevents the front of the hood from taking over your face.There are nice pockets with zippers plus interior pouches. There are a few reflective strips which can help in the dark for safety. Drawstrings around the wait to help seal you up. Overall a good product so far but that hood brings it down from 5 to 4 for me.

By randy k
Date: March 26, 2022
Product is as expected - very wind and waterproof - but also not breathable. Waist and hood both easily adjustable, but sleeves are fitted elastic. Jacket fit as expected and long enough for average sized person.Purchased it for spring weather bike riding and performed well on several wet rides - but in fairer weather it does not breathe and really heats up inside. It does have a vent in the back - but no other zippered or other openings. For a $40 windbreaker that does 2 out of 3 things well I give it a 4 rating for good overall value.
